在CSS中,隐藏div的方法主要有两种:使用display: none属性:说明:此方法会完全隐藏div元素,包括其中的文本和图片,且不占用页面空间。被隐藏的内容不会被搜索引擎读取。语法:这里你是看不到的特点:隐藏彻底,不占用页面布局空间。使用overflow: hidden属性:说明:此方法用于隐藏超出div容器宽高的内容,...
以下是实现CSS隐藏页面元素的11种常用方法:display: none;:说明:完全移除元素的渲染,元素在页面上彻底消失,不占据空间。特点:不触发事件,无过渡效果,可能导致浏览器重排和重绘。visibility: hidden;:说明:元素在页面中仍然占据空间,但不渲染,因此不触发事件。特点:保留元素的原始位置,不影响布局。
总结: display: none和visibility: hidden是两种常用且功能完整的隐藏方法,适用于大多数常规隐藏需求。 opacity: 0、调整盒模型属性、position: absolute以及clippath等方法则更多用于实现特殊视觉效果或布局调整,而非常规隐藏。请根据实际需求选择最适合的隐藏方法。
display: none和visibility: hidden是最常用的隐藏元素方法,分别适用于需要完全移除元素和保留元素空间但不显示的场景。opacity: 0适用于需要保留元素空间并通过透明度实现渐变效果的场景。设置height、width等盒模型属性为0和设置position与left、top等属性将元素移出屏幕外等方法适用于需要灵活控制元素显示状态...
9. 调整尺寸;:通过修改宽度、高度、填充、边距或字体大小来缩小元素,从而使其在视觉上不可见。10. 覆盖元素;:放置一个与背景颜色相同的元素在原元素之上,使其在视觉上被隐藏。这种方法需要额外的HTML代码。11. transform 属性;:除了上述方法,还可以通过平移、缩放、旋转或倾斜等变换属性,使得元素...